Position Summary
We are seeking a Frontend Web Developer to design, develop, and maintain modern, accessible, and responsive web applications. The successful candidate will leverage Angular, JavaScript, HTML/CSS, and Design System components to create exceptional user experiences while ensuring compliance with WCAG 2.1 AA accessibility standards.
Key Responsibilities- Design, develop, and maintain responsive web applications using Angular, JavaScript, HTML, and CSS.
- Build reusable UI components utilizing established Design System standards and components.
- Translate Figma designs and prototypes into high-quality, production-ready user interfaces.
- Develop and execute automated UI and end-to-end tests using Selenium and Cypress.
- Collaborate closely with UX designers, accessibility specialists, and backend developers.
- Contribute to the development and enhancement of Design System components.
- Ensure all frontend implementations meet WCAG 2.1 AA accessibility requirements.
- Optimize application performance, usability, and responsiveness across browsers and devices.
- Troubleshoot and resolve frontend defects and user experience issues.
- Participate in code reviews and follow established development standards and best practices.
- Maintain technical documentation related to frontend development and testing activities.
